Odor is often the first sign Cumberland Furnace customers notice, well before any visible water shows up.
Stair-step cracks in block foundations are a common early warning sign we see across Cumberland Furnace-area homes.
That white chalky film on basement walls is efflorescence — mineral deposits left behind as water evaporates through concrete.
If your pump is running around the clock instead of only during storms, it's worth having it evaluated before it fails completely.
